Today’s motion
Should public-sector banks be privatised in India?
For
Recapitalisation has cost the exchequer more than ₹3.1 lakh crore since 2015. That money bought no structural change in how lending decisions get made.
Against
Private banks did not open the rural branches that made Jan Dhan work. Cost to the exchequer is not the only ledger.
Opponent · the cost figure is doing all the work here. It answers “was it expensive”, not “would privatising fix it”.
